In Geany .21 I'm having a weird problem where there text is always the same color, there is no auto-change for different syntax. I've tried different color schemes, the default, etc. Tried re-installing Geany but that didn't fix it. Also, there's always a white vertical line in the middle of Geany which I haven't seen before. I can't find anything on the web related to this issue. Attached are two screenshots of a default Rails Gemfile, one using the default Geany color scheme and one using the Dark theme.

Any ideas? Thanks.

Has geany been able to identify the document type? It normally uses the file name. It it's not the normal filename extension, Geany may just be treating is as a plain text file. Use the menu Document -> Set filetype to make sure geany knows how to colour it.
